Definition of ala - Reverso English Dictionary
Noun
1.
medicalTECH. winglike structure in bones or cartilagesTECH.
- The ala of the sacrum is prominent in the skeleton.
2.
entomologyTECH. wing of an insectTECH.
- The butterfly's ala was vibrant and colorful.
3.
architectureRare small room in ancient Roman buildingsRare
- The ala opened into the main courtyard of the villa.
4.
plantTECH. flattened border of stems or seedsTECH.
- The ala of the seed helps it disperse in the wind.

Origin of ala
Latin, ala (wing)

Definition of ALA - Reverso English Dictionary
Acronym
1.
acr: American Library AssociationTECH. US supports libraries and librarians in AmericaTECH. US
- The ALA hosts an annual conference.
2.
acr: Alpha-Linolenic AcidTECH. US healthy fat found in some plants and seedsTECH. US
- ALA is important for a balanced diet.
3.
acr: Alabama Lawyers AssociationTECH. US group supporting lawyers in AlabamaTECH. US
- The ALA is hosting a seminar next week.
